Re: can i feed my gsp's live meal worms?

Post by recombinantrider »

I used to feed my GSP mealworms. He liked it for the first one or two days, and then they lost interest. The outer skin of the mealworms is very hard to digest for the puffers, and I think the fat content is really high so they're not exactly the best food for your puffers.

P.S. I fed my GSP a beetle that morphed from a mealworm once too. He liked it and went nuts.
